SOS是一个扩展DLL,允许使用Windows调试工具(如WinDbg)中的调试器调试托管.NET代码。
我搜索并尝试了很多东西,但无法让psscor4正常工作。 当我调用 !threads 时,我总是得到 请求ThreadStore失败 我检查的内容如下: 我是
VS2005 C# 编译器在我们团队的夜间构建过程中崩溃。 我使用 WinDBG 附加到它,加载 SOS 扩展,打印调用堆栈,但看不到异常信息。 我尝试了 !PrintException,如
我正在尝试使用 WinDBG 分析我们一台生产机器的故障转储。我的问题的根源似乎是我的 .NET 框架构建与生产机器不同......
我正在尝试以两种方式绘制滤波器响应,一种是针对时间绘制,另一种是针对频率绘制。我现在的目标是绘制级联滤波器、filter1 和 filter2。 反对频率的阴谋...
我正在寻找 SOS 的 !SyncBlk 命令生成的输出的描述。 特别是我在“MonitorHeld”列中没有找到有用的解释。此列显示了系列中的高值...
是否有 Windbg/NTSD 命令可以告诉我在实时调试会话中附加的进程是 32 位进程还是 64 位进程? 您能告诉我两者吗: 不受管理的流程? 一个...
如果数组包含100000000个item,那么输出所有items就太长了,请问我是否只想用windbg输出数组中的10个item,比如!da前10个地址,如何处理。 ..
为什么我会在此方法中看到对 WaitForMultipleObjectsEx 的调用?
我有一个 .NET Windows 窗体应用程序,它偶尔会处于挂起状态。当我转储进程并通过 WinDbg/SOS 打开它时,它显示一个线程调用了 kernel32!
我有 SOS 学校项目,截止日期临近。我偶然发现了一个问题。我无法通过已保存的联系人发送短信。我不知道为什么。我每天都在编码,但仍然找不到 pr...
我正在做一个项目,我在其中创建了一个按钮。我想添加一个功能,如果我点击那个按钮,它会自动拨打警察号码 (100)。 我写了...
当用户尝试登录他们的仪表板时,我的 php 脚本代码继续提供错误 500 消息。突然间它工作正常,它开始服务于错误。以下是截图...
我可以在windbg脚本中使用poi来遍历字段,然后打印我感兴趣的字段。例如,如果我有所有类型为X的对象,其中有字段X.y.z,z是一个数组,其中y在......。
我不知道我现在在做什么,例如,如果我想通过抛出新的ApplicationException(“ User name已经存在”);通过Struts在服务器端抛出异常,我想抓住这个.. 。
为了遍历本机对象,我可以将其存储在windbg变量中,然后对windbg中的字段进行linq查询,以过滤相关对象。 > dx @ $ usedSessions =(*(((FabricRuntime!std :: ...
[我的任务是:编写一个程序,该程序将:查找所有以数字结尾的txt文件(例如tekstas5.txt)。通过将数字放在文件名的开头来重命名它们。首先一切都很好,但是如何...
我有一个附有windbg的迷你转储。小型转储来自运行在IIS上的.NET 4.6.1 ASP.NET站点。我想获取我的枚举的定义,但是每当我得到...
在WinDBG / SOS.DLL中:如何将!DumpDomain列出的所有模块/组件立即保存到磁盘?
我有一个可在运行时通过内存流动态加载大量dll的应用程序。使用WinDBG,当使用命令!DumpDomain时,我可以看到已加载的模块。使用其他命令(例如!lm)...
使用WinDbg和SOS分析转储文件:如何获取所有当前正在执行的请求的URL?
我有一个来自w3c进程的转储文件,我需要对其进行分析。根据“!DumpHeap -type HttpRequest”,当前到服务器有大约三千个活动连接。问题是...
我使用的是国家开发银行与sosex扩展。似乎一切都工作正常,只是我无法得到任何!MBP断点来解决和!亩/!MUF不显示源信息。得到与去...
如何评估从S.O.S.在Silverlight / WPF依赖属性?
这个问题是相当简单 - 我想使用S.O.S. Silverlight应用程序调试内存泄漏我是能够得到使用!gcroot来确定哪些对象有一些很好的信息...